Sigurd has been in his current role at DSB since May 2018. In September
of this year, he also became acting head of the Norwegian Civil Defence.
Prior to DSB, he had a 28-year career in the Norwegian armed forces.
He holds the rank of colonel, and was a battalion commander in the army.
He also led the armed forces’ IT infrastructure department.
Sigurd was educated at the Norwegian Military Academy, the
Norwegian Defence University College and the NATO Defence College,
where he specialised in strategic challenges in the high north.

Christophe graduated from the
telecommunication branch of the Royal Military
Academy in Brussels. He holds a Master’s degree in
management from the Louvain School of Management.
He joined ASTRID in 2000, at the early phase of its deployment. He
has held various management positions in the organisation, including
Program Manager, Operations Manager, Projects Portfolio Manager, and
Quality and Business Process Manager.
As Director of Technology and Operations - since 2013 - he has
been in charge of day-to-day ASTRID services, as well as the network’s
ongoing evolution.
